Analysis

North America recorded 0 current US$ for net oda received per capita in 2023.

Over the whole period, net oda received per capita in North America peaked at 0.1521 current US$ in 1990 and was at its lowest, -0.0427 current US$, in 1994.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Net official development assistance (ODA) per capita consists of disbursements of loans made on concessional terms (net of repayments of principal) and grants by official agencies of the members of the Development Assistance Committee (DAC), by multilateral institutions, and by non-DAC countries to promote economic development and welfare in countries and territories in the DAC list of ODA recipients; and is calculated by dividing net ODA received by the midyear population estimate. It includes loans with a grant element of at least 25 percent (calculated at a rate of discount of 10 percent).
